Background:

  • Kikuchi's necrotizing lymphadenitis is a rare, benign condition.
  • It primarily affects lymph nodes, often in the neck.

Observation:

  • Two cases of Kikuchi's disease were diagnosed at our hospital.
  • Key clinical signs included enlarged cervical lymph nodes, fever, elevated erythrocyte sedimentation rate, and leukopenia.

Findings:

  • Histological examination confirmed the diagnosis in both cases.
  • The condition followed a generally benign and self-limited course.

Implications:

  • This report highlights the rare occurrence of Kikuchi's disease in Spain.
  • Accurate histological diagnosis is crucial for managing this self-limiting condition.
